To determine the role of the choroidal vasculature in the pathogenesis of exudative retinal detachments in preeclampsia using indocyanine green angiography.
We reviewed both fluorescein and indocyanine green angiographic findings for four patients with preeclampsia.
Indocyanine green angiographic findings in patients with preeclampsia include nonperfusion in the early phases of the angiogram and staining of the choroidal vasculature with subretinal leakage in the late phases of the angiogram and multiple punctate areas of blocked fluorescence.
Indocyanine green angiography indicates that damage to the choroidal vasculature leads to many of the retinal changes seen in preeclampsia.
使用吲哚菁绿血管造影术确定脉络膜血管系统在子痫前期渗出性视网膜脱离发病机制中的作用。
我们回顾了4例子痫前期患者的荧光素和吲哚菁绿血管造影结果。
子痫前期患者的吲哚菁绿血管造影结果包括血管造影早期的无灌注、血管造影晚期脉络膜血管系统的染色伴视网膜下渗漏以及多个点状荧光遮蔽区。
吲哚菁绿血管造影表明,脉络膜血管系统损伤导致了子痫前期所见的许多视网膜改变。
